On some proof theoretical properties of the modal logic GL
Studia Logica 42 (4):453 - 459 (1983)
| Abstract | This paper deals with the system of modal logicGL, in particular with a formulation of it in terms of sequents. We prove some proof theoretical properties ofGL that allow to get the cut-elimination theorem according to Gentzen's procedure, that is, by double induction on grade and rank. | |||||||||
